Chaos Experiment Design
Purpose
Produce complete, safe, runnable chaos experiments following the hypothesis-driven scientific method. Every experiment has a clear hypothesis, defined steady state, bounded blast radius, and automated abort conditions.
Input Contract
| Input | Source | Required |
|---|---|---|
| PRD / service criticality analysis | s01 (workflow_context) | Yes |
| Pipeline YAML (chaos step location) | s04 output | Yes |
| Service definitions (target services) | s05 output | Yes |
| Blast radius budget per environment | s01 (env tier table) | Yes |
| Feature flag chaos gate config | s08 output | No (recommended) |
| Risk tolerance preferences | s02 taste (risk_tolerance) | Yes |

Prerequisites
- LitmusChaos / Harness Chaos Engineering installed in target cluster
- Target namespace and service identified
- Steady state defined (see chaos/04-steady-state-definition)
- Observability stack active (metrics flowing before experiment starts)
- Rollback plan documented
- Blast radius approved for target environment (see CLAUDE.md env tiers)
Experiment Design Framework (5 Steps)
1. HYPOTHESIS → "If X fails, then Y should happen, and Z metric stays within N"
2. STEADY STATE → Baseline metrics confirmed healthy before injection
3. FAULT → Specific fault, target scope, duration, intensity
4. OBSERVE → Monitor during injection — did system behave as expected?
5. LEARN → Document findings, fix gaps, update runbooks
